Usually that's much easier stated than done. Wholesale genuine estate investing is the ideal arbitrage opportunity for a financier to turn a quick and healthy profit. Real estate wholesalers don't make their money by seizing the home. Rather, they find highly inspired sellers in distress, properly estimate the repair cost and reasonable market value of the house, then assign the agreement to another financier in exchange for a fixed profit.

Important things to consider consist of: Fair market property values and whether they are trending up or down. Market leas to let you understand what the true income potential of a property is and if it will be cash flow positive. Don't pay too much, since money is made in real estate when the residential or commercial property is bought, not when it's sold.
Till you're all set to join the ranks of the ultra-wealthy, it is essential to make certain you have access to lots of capital. That's because investing in property in some cases needs more cash than anticipated. Plan on putting a minimum of 20% down for a rental property, set up a separate capital reserve account for repair Discover more here work and maintenance, and aspect in the loss of money flow created by jobs and the time it requires to turn a tenant.
Financiers can avoid potential issues and lawsuits by comprehending the regional and state laws that govern genuine estate: Eviction processes differ from location to location and may restrict your rights as a landlord. Conducting background checks on prospective occupants assists prevent renting to problem tenants in the first location. However, constantly make certain to treat every candidate relatively and similarly.
Insurance protection for rental property varies from owner-occupied homes and must include basic liability coverage that protects you against claims from the renter or the occupant's guests.
